Tennessee baseball blown out by LSU in series finale for third SEC series loss in April

Tennessee baseball faced another setback with a loss to LSU, marking their third SEC series defeat in April for the first time since 2023. The Volunteers also dropped series to Texas A&M and Kentucky, signaling a challenging period in their season.
